Catalog description

This course will introduce to discipline of conservation biology. The first two-thirds of the course will focus on the biological aspects of the discipline. Topics covered will include patterns of biodiversity and extinction, causes of extinction and population declines, techniques used to restore populations, landscape level conservation planning, and the role of conservation in protecting ecosytems services. The final third will cover the practical aspects of implementing conservation actions and will include lectures on conservation economics and conservation law.
